Socket
Socket
Sign inDemoInstall

@helm-charts/agones-agones

Package Overview
Dependencies
1
Maintainers
2
Versions
14
Alerts
File Explorer

Advanced tools

Install Socket

Detect and block malicious and high-risk dependencies

Install

    @helm-charts/agones-agones

a library for hosting, running and scaling dedicated game servers on Kubernetes.


Version published
Maintainers
2
Created

Readme

Source

@helm-charts/agones-agones

a library for hosting, running and scaling dedicated game servers on Kubernetes.

FieldValue
Repository Nameagones
Chart Nameagones
Chart Version0.9.0-rc
NPM Package Version0.1.0
Helm chart `values.yaml` (default values)
# Copyright 2018 Google Inc. All Rights Reserved.
#
# Licensed under the Apache License, Version 2.0 (the "License");
# you may not use this file except in compliance with the License.
# You may obtain a copy of the License at
#
#     http://www.apache.org/licenses/LICENSE-2.0
#
# Unless required by applicable law or agreed to in writing, software
# distributed under the License is distributed on an "AS IS" BASIS,
#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
# See the License for the specific language governing permissions and
# limitations under the License.

# Declare variables to be passed into your templates.

agones:
  metrics:
    prometheusEnabled: true
    prometheusServiceDiscovery: true
    stackdriverEnabled: false
    stackdriverProjectID: ''
  rbacEnabled: true
  registerServiceAccounts: true
  registerWebhooks: true
  crds:
    install: true
    cleanupOnDelete: true
  serviceaccount:
    controller: agones-controller
    sdk: agones-sdk
  createPriorityClass: true
  priorityClassName: agones-system
  controller:
    resources: {}
    nodeSelector: {}
    tolerations:
      - key: 'stable.agones.dev/agones-system'
        operator: 'Equal'
        value: 'true'
        effect: 'NoExecute'
    affinity:
      nodeAffinity:
        preferredDuringSchedulingIgnoredDuringExecution:
          - weight: 1
            preference:
              matchExpressions:
                - key: stable.agones.dev/agones-system
                  operator: Exists
    generateTLS: true
    safeToEvict: false
    persistentLogs: true
    persistentLogsSizeLimitMB: 10000
    numWorkers: 100
    apiServerQPS: 400
    apiServerQPSBurst: 500
    http:
      port: 8080
    healthCheck:
      initialDelaySeconds: 3
      periodSeconds: 3
      failureThreshold: 3
      timeoutSeconds: 1
  ping:
    install: true
    resources: {}
    nodeSelector: {}
    tolerations:
      - key: 'stable.agones.dev/agones-system'
        operator: 'Equal'
        value: 'true'
        effect: 'NoExecute'
    affinity:
      nodeAffinity:
        preferredDuringSchedulingIgnoredDuringExecution:
          - weight: 1
            preference:
              matchExpressions:
                - key: stable.agones.dev/agones-system
                  operator: Exists
    replicas: 2
    http:
      expose: true
      response: ok
      port: 80
      serviceType: LoadBalancer
    udp:
      expose: true
      rateLimit: 20
      port: 50000
      serviceType: LoadBalancer
    healthCheck:
      initialDelaySeconds: 3
      periodSeconds: 3
      failureThreshold: 3
      timeoutSeconds: 1
  image:
    registry: gcr.io/agones-images
    tag: 0.9.0-rc
    controller:
      name: agones-controller
      pullPolicy: IfNotPresent
    sdk:
      name: agones-sdk
      cpuRequest: 30m
      cpuLimit: 0
      alwaysPull: false
    ping:
      name: agones-ping
      pullPolicy: IfNotPresent

gameservers:
  namespaces:
    - default
  minPort: 7000
  maxPort: 8000

Install Agones using Helm

This chart installs the Agones application and defines deployment on a Kubernetes cluster using the Helm package manager.

See Install Agones using Helm for installation and configuration instructions.

FAQs

Last updated on 22 Apr 2019

Did you know?

Socket for GitHub automatically highlights issues in each pull request and monitors the health of all your open source dependencies. Discover the contents of your packages and block harmful activity before you install or update your dependencies.

Install

Related posts

S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c